What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a senior Linux system engineer?

To thrive as a Senior Linux System Engineer, you need deep expertise in Linux operating systems, scripting (such as Bash, Python, or Perl), system architecture, and a relevant degree or equivalent experience. Familiarity with configuration management tools (like Ansible or Puppet), virtualization platforms, cloud services, and certifications such as RHCE or LPIC are highly valued. Strong problem-solving, collaboration, and communication skills help you efficiently manage complex environments and mentor junior staff. These capabilities are crucial for ensuring system stability, security, and scalability in mission-critical IT infrastructures.

What are some common challenges a senior Linux system engineer faces when managing large-scale server environments?

Senior Linux System Engineers often encounter challenges related to maintaining system uptime, managing complex configurations, and ensuring security across a large number of servers. Troubleshooting issues in distributed environments, automating repetitive tasks, and keeping systems up-to-date with the latest patches are also frequent responsibilities. Collaboration with development, security, and networking teams is essential to resolve cross-functional issues and implement new solutions efficiently. Staying current with evolving technologies and best practices is key to overcoming these challenges and excelling in the role.

What does a senior Linux system engineer do?

A Senior Linux System Engineer is responsible for designing, implementing, maintaining, and troubleshooting Linux-based systems and servers within an organization. They ensure the reliability, security, and optimal performance of these systems, often leading projects and mentoring junior engineers. Their tasks may include automation, scripting, system updates, monitoring, and responding to incidents. They also collaborate with other IT teams to support business needs and implement best practices for system administration.

We're seeking Senior Right-of-Way Engineers to support right-of-way engineering activities on major transit capital programs, delivered through traditional and alternative methods including design-build and progressive design-build. You'll lead property rights acquisition, right-of-way standards administration, and negotiation efforts that keep megaprogram schedules and budgets on track.

Responsibilities may include, but are not limited to, the following:
  • Lead efforts to secure necessary property rights supporting design, construction, operation, and maintainability of transit facilities and systems.
  • Oversee right-of-way scope-of-work requirements for consultants across design phases and construction delivery methods.
  • Direct consultants responsible for property rights determination, civil certification deliverables, and appraisal documentation, reviewing plans, specifications, and related deliverables for conformance with right-of-way standards and best practices.
  • Lead development of technical property acquisition documents, including deeds, easements, agreements, covenants and restrictions, plats, parcel maps, and legal descriptions, for private property owners, third parties, and utilities across design, construction, and closeout phases.
  • Develop right-of-way standards and administer related processes program-wide.
  • Oversee the Right-of-Entry (ROE) process, including form development and approval.
  • Support preparation of Real Property Acquisition Plans, coordinating agency, state, and third-party right-of-way interests.
  • Represent right-of-way interests in negotiations, mediations, and trials with property owners; coordinate with construction management to interpret property rights and administer temporary construction easements.
  • Coordinate with operations and facilities teams after construction to interpret acquired property rights, develop maintenance plans, and negotiate access agreements.
  • Mentor and provide technical direction to right-of-way engineering staff.
